- High-quality photos are another way to analyze the condition of a car, which is a priority for most buyers. Combined with the vehicle's history, they allow you to judge the advisability of a purchase.
- Mileage helps to understand how intensively the car has been used, whether there have been long periods of inactivity or regular trips.
- The specifications provide detailed information about the technical characteristics and installed equipment, allowing you to compare the current version with the factory specifications.
- Delivery cost and route are important parameters that affect the total cost of your auction purchase.
- The Operational readiness section provides information about technical soundness and readiness for operation.
- The VIN number can be used to determine the actual number of owners, find out the vehicle's history, identify legal restrictions, and compare the data with the seller's claims.
- Having two original keys indicates that the car is fully equipped and serves as indirect proof that it has a transparent history, has not been stolen, and has not had its locks changed. They also indicate careful use and increase liquidity on the secondary market.
